The appeal against the former Minister for Environment ruling that accepted evidence of a First Nations Dreaming story to halt a gold mine site near Blayney, NSW continues today.

2nd day of hearings in Sydney’s Federal Court of this highly significant ruling.

Aboriginal deaths in custody numbers are rising

Senator Thorpe said the government must honour its stated intention to restrict funding to jurisdictions that drive up incarceration rates, adding that community-led alternatives are proven to be safer and more cost-effective.

#auspol
Australia is facing its worst year for Aboriginal deaths in custody in nearly half a century, with a new Australian Institute of Criminology report confirming 33 First Nations deaths in 2024–25 — the highest toll since 1979–80.
